Rac is looking for a qualified Roadside Technician to join their team, offering a base salary of £36,400 and an OTE of £61,000. You’ll provide expert roadside repair and diagnostics, ensuring members can get back on the road quickly.

The ideal candidate should have a Level 2 Light Vehicle Maintenance qualification and at least 2 years of relevant experience.

Benefits include generous holidays, pension contributions, and wellbeing support.

How to prepare for a job interview at RAC

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ge related to roadside repairs and diagnostics. Be prepared to discuss specific scenarios where you've successfully resolved issues, as this will show your expertise and experience in the field.

Showcase Your Qualifications

Since a Level 2 Light Vehicle Maintenance qualification is essential, have your certification ready to discuss. Highlight how your qualifications have directly contributed to your success in previous roles, and be ready to explain any relevant training or courses you've completed.

Demonstrate Problem-Solving Skills

Prepare to share examples of challenging situations you've faced as a technician. Discuss how you approached these problems, the solutions you implemented, and the outcomes. This will illustrate your ability to think on your feet and provide excellent service under pressure.

Emphasise Teamwork and Communication

As a Roadside Technician, you'll often work with other team members and communicate with customers. Be ready to talk about your experiences working in a team environment and how you ensure clear communication, especially when dealing with stressed customers in roadside situations.
